Blast Resistant Building Design & Engineering
Guardian follows a comprehensive engineering process to ensure every structure meets project-specific security and performance objectives.
Threat Assessment
We identify potential threats, define protection requirements, and establish project performance criteria.
Blast Analysis
Advanced engineering software evaluates blast overpressure, shock wave effects, and structural response.
Structural Modeling
Detailed 3D structural models simulate real-world blast scenarios and help prevent progressive collapse.
Material Selection
Premium construction materials are selected based on structural performance, durability, and blast resistance.
Performance-Based Design
Every building is engineered to comply with internationally recognized blast protection principles while supporting operational functionality.
Project Engineering
Comprehensive engineering documentation supports seamless fabrication, construction, installation, and project delivery.

Frequently Asked Questions
What are blast resistant buildings?
Blast resistant buildings are specially engineered structures designed to withstand explosive forces, reduce structural damage, and protect occupants and critical assets.
How do blast resistant buildings work?
They use reinforced structural systems, blast-resistant materials, specialized engineering, and energy-absorbing construction methods to reduce the effects of explosions.
Can existing buildings be upgraded?
Yes. Existing facilities can often be retrofitted with blast-resistant walls, doors, windows, and structural reinforcements to improve protection.
Which industries require blast resistant buildings?
Government, defense, oil & gas, petrochemical, utilities, mining, transportation, aviation, and industrial manufacturing sectors commonly require blast-resistant facilities.
